Lorna Tolentino now a certified Kapuso

Lolit Solis (Lorna's manager), GMA President and COO Gilberto R. Duavit, Jr., Lorna, GMA Chairman and CEO Atty. Felipe L. Gozon and GMA Entertainment TV's OIC Lilybeth G. Rasonable (Photo courtesy of GMA Network)

Lorna Tolentino jumped ship once more, this time from TV5 to GMA-7.

The multi-awarded actress signed an exclusive two-year contract with the Kapuso network on Thursday, October 11.

According to a press release sent to Yahoo! Philippines OMG! Lorna feels glad to come "home" to GMA after four years.

Among the drama series Lorna did for the network  were "Now and Forever," "Linlang", "Sugo" and "Hanggang Kailan".

"I’m very happy to be back. I am happy kasi GMA is my home na rin, home naman nating lahat ito," Lorna said.

GMA Chairman and CEO Atty. Felipe L. Gozon says Lorna is "very welcome" in GMA.

"Isa siya sa pinakamagagaling na artistang kilala natin," Atty. Gozon added.

GMA has lined up "an even better project" than the shelved "Haram" primetime series for the returning Kapuso.

"Yung ipapalit na project is with the same cast and even better. Heavy drama ito. We cannot see anybody to play the role except Ms Lorna. She is a big boost in GMA’s stable of stars," GMA Entertainment TV’s OIC Lilybeth G. Rasonable said.
